    Frontal lobe disorder, also frontal lobe syndrome, is an impairment of the frontal lobe of the brain due to disease or frontal lobe injury. [5] The frontal lobe plays a key role in executive functions such as motivation, planning, social behaviour, and speech production.     The frontal lobe is the largest of the four major lobes of the brain in mammals, and is located at the front of each cerebral hemisphere (in front of the parietal lobe and the temporal lobe).     The most frequent cause of the syndrome is brain damage to the frontal lobe. Brain damage leading to the dysexecutive pattern of symptoms can result from physical trauma such as a blow to the head or a stroke [6] or other internal trauma. It is important to note that frontal lobe damage is not the only cause of the syndrome.

    People with left inferior frontal lobe damage produced less facial expression and could not analyze emotional situations as well as those with right frontal lobe damage especially with fear and disgust. [n 9] The left inferior frontal gyrus (IFG) plays an important role in anger while the right IFG plays a larger role in disgust. [14]

    The frontal eye fields (FEF) are a region located in the frontal cortex, more specifically in Brodmann area 8 or BA8, [1] of the primate brain. In humans, it can be more accurately said to lie in a region around the intersection of the middle frontal gyrus with the precentral gyrus , consisting of a frontal and parietal portion. [ 2 ]

    Damage in the watershed region does not directly harm the areas of the brain involved in language production or comprehension; instead, the damage isolates these areas from the rest of the brain.
